How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Health Professions from UT Knoxville Cost?

$13,264 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

UT Knoxville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Out-of-state part-time undergraduates at UT Knoxville paid an average of $1,137 per credit hour in 2019-2020. The average for in-state students was $378 per credit hour. The average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ates are sh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$11,332$28,522
Fees$1,932$2,162
Books and Supplies$1,598$1,598
On Campus Room and Board$11,856$11,856
On Campus Other Expenses$5,780$5,780

UT Knoxville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Health Professions

335 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
89.9% Women
11.0%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 335 students received their bachelor’s degree in health professions.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 89.9% of the health professions students who took home a bachelor’s degree in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 84.4%.

undefined

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Around 11.0% of health professions bachelor’s degree recipients at UT Knoxville in 2019-2020 were awarded to racial-ethnic minorities*. This is lower than the nationwide number of 36%.

undefined
Race/EthnicityNumber of Students
Asian11
Black or African American15
Hispanic or Latino5
Native American or Alaska Native0
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ander0
White292
International Students0
Other Races/Ethnicities12
